The COOPER LIGHTING MSLED300 is a solar-powered, motion-activated LED wedge light rated at 300 lumens — equivalent output to a 40-watt incandescent lamp. Operating at 5,000 Kelvin, it delivers a crisp, daylight-range color temperature suited for exterior security and pathway lighting. An integrated battery pack stores solar charge and provides up to 60 minutes of continuous run time on a full charge. The built-in motion sensor covers a 120-degree detection arc, and an integrated timer shuts the light off automatically after 1 minute of inactivity. Installation requires no line-voltage wiring, making it appropriate for property managers, electricians, and knowledgeable DIYers working on low-maintenance exterior lighting projects.
The MSLED300 is designed for residential and light commercial exterior applications where running conduit or low-voltage wiring is impractical or undesirable. Typical install locations include building entryways, walkways, garage walls, fences, and outbuilding exteriors. The wedge-style form factor allows surface mounting on flat vertical surfaces. Because the unit is self-contained and solar-powered, it is well suited for remote structures — sheds, barns, and detached garages — where utility power is not readily available. Each package contains two units.
Designed as a self-contained solar LED wedge light for standard exterior surface-mount applications on flat vertical surfaces.
The MSLED300 requires no electrical rough-in or low-voltage wiring and can be installed by electricians or qualified DIYers using basic hand tools. Mount on a flat, vertical exterior surface with direct southern sky exposure to maximize daily solar charge. Verify the mounting surface is structurally sound before fastening. Position the motion sensor zone to cover the intended detection area without pointing the solar panel toward obstructions or shade.
